How to connect your Amazon Echo Show to RESNET_WIFI Step 1 Find the MAC address for your Amazon Echo Show so that you can register your device and obtain a password to connect to RESNET_WIFI. To do this connect the device as advised by Amazon and follow the on-screen instructions as follows: Select the device language: Scroll down to the very bottom of the next screen entitled ‘Connect to Network’.

Step 2 Registering your device to obtain a RESNET_WIFI password You now need to register your Amazon Echo Show to obtain the password needed to connect your Firestick to RESNET_WIFI. To do this, use your mobile phone/tablet/laptop, ensure you can connect to the internet and have set up eduroam wi-fi on this device using these instructions on MySurrey.
